ZIP Code 78621: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 78621?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 78621 is $320,800, higher than 72%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 78621?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 78621 is $5,244, an effective rate of 2%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 78621 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 78621 cost about 3.26× the median household income, higher than 59%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the average rent in ZIP Code 78621?
- The median gross rent in ZIP Code 78621 is $1,387 a month, higher than 80%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much have home prices grown in ZIP Code 78621?
- Home prices in ZIP Code 78621 have moved 48% over the past five years (7.6% in the past year), per the FHFA House Price Index.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 78621?
- ZIP Code 78621 averages 68°F year-round, summer highs near 94.3°F, winter lows around 41°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als).
- Is ZIP Code 78621 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 78621's FEMA National Risk Index score is 63.1 (near the U.S. ZIP codes median).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is tornado.
